I work for oral surgeon's and this will only get worse. Ibuprofen can help with the swelling - up to 800mg every 8 hours. In the mean time, as sore as tissues are, try to brush/rinse under the inflammed tissue (plague is building up under tissue where tooth is attempting to break through.) Chronic inflammation leads to infection. Antibiotics would be helpful too. You could try going to the emergency room. Most have oral surgeons that they work with and then maybe you can work out a payment plan. good luck.
